Another Color Variation of the Extruded Swirl Cane

Here is the other color combo I did with the Extruded Swirl Cane Tutorial I shared with you last week.  I did this one in the Pantone Spring 2010 colors of Tomato Puree, Fusion Coral and Pink Champagne and used the same three extruder dies as the last cane experiment.


This color combo is a little more subtle and makes a nice soft blend.  Here are some pieces I made with the above canes.  I only did a small cane for this one as an experiment but I still managed to make a few things with it.  I decided to put some cane slices on a black background to really make the colors pop a little more and added some bling with some rhinestones.


It was fun experimenting with this technique and I'm starting to see more possibilities with it that I might try out later.

New Designs in Tomato Puree

I've been busy catching up with some custom orders to fill from our last show as well as finishing off and  listing some new pieces on Etsy and Art Fire.  My favorite color is the yellow-greens and when I'm working with my clay I have to occasionally remind myself that there are other colors in the rainbow.

I noticed we didn't have very much in red and so created some new pieces in the Pantone Spring 2010 color of Tomato Puree.  I combined it with  Fusion Coral and Pink Champagne which really softened the red for a nice romantic spring and summer combination.


Both of the pendants are on the ruby red softglass cords with Czech Fire-polished crystals.

   

I like to make all our own sterling and gold-filled earwires as I can create the earwire to suit the actual earring for the overall design.  I have much more control in the finished product this way.

I really like the new Pantone Spring colors this year and have had a lot of fun in combining them in many ways and have been happy with the results.
